Pending Credits definition

Pending Credits has the meaning specified in Section 7.3.
Pending Credits means emission reduction credits for which an application has been submitted under R18-2-1203, R18-2- 1204, or R18-2-1205 but that have not yet been issued as conditional or certified credits.
